INDUSTRIAL ROBOTICS LAB
MTE 2141
Syllabus
- 01Introduction to Robot Studio an offline Programming Tool
- 02Defining Targets and Trajectory Generation
- 03Creating a Custom Tool and Defining a Work object
- 04Conveyor Tracking using Robot Studio
- 05Manual programming using Teach pendant for IRB2600
- 06Control of Digital Inputs and Outputs through IRB2600 Robot
- 07automation applications with industrial robot IRB2600 and collaborative robot Universal Robot UR5
- 08Control of Stepper Motor and servo motor actuators using Raspberry PI
- 09PID Control of Lego Line Following Robot
- 10Robot Vision- with image processing software or Open CV
- 11Kinematic modeling of the industrial robot
- 12knowledge of Sensors and actuators for case study or mini project
